(STUDIO CITY, CA) Melissa J.L. Smith, Principal at This Is Production, Inc., Director of Marketing and Public Relations at Timepiece Entertainment and freelance writer has been recognized by Cambridge Who's Who for her outstanding achievement in the entertainment industry.

Possessing the ability to find innovative solutions to business challenges, Ms. Smith is recognized for her broad-based experience, which has made her a power player in several arenas at most of the major Hollywood studios.

The wide bandwidth of Smith's career is reflected in the strengths of This Is Production, Inc., a consulting firm that specializes in writing and marketing services, project management, studio operations management, event coordination, post-production sound management, animation, and administration management. Having substantial experience in all of the preceding areas of the motion picture/television business, Melissa serves as a principal of the company. The company's clients include both large corporations and small businesses. Smith also is an accomplished producer/writer whose credits include documentaries, MOUNTAIN MAGIC MELODY, THE FOLKS IN THEM "THAR" HILLS, and WHAT ON EARTH IS A COAL TIPPLE?. She also was the producer/writer for the television series, CHOICE CUTS and PURE COUNTRY. Her most recent writing projects include television pilot, EV'RY ROSE HAS ITS THORN and LUCE AND WILDE.

Ms. Smith also serves as the Director of Marketing and Public Relations for Timepiece Entertainment where her responsibilities include the company's public relations and promotional operations, coordinating events, managing projects and marketing, and overseeing process design. Current Timepiece projects include feature films, ALL ALONE, WINGS OF ANGELS, and BRAY, off-Broadway stage play CANVAS FALCONS, and additional feature films and television shows in development.

Ms. Smith has worked in the entertainment industry for 20 years, and rather than simply weathering many changes, she has repeatedly found ways to help studios improve their bottom line. She is a veteran of Lorimar-Telepictures and Sony Pictures Studios. Additionally, she has worked for NBC Television Network, Universal Studios, The Walt Disney Company and Warner Bros. Studios.

While at Warner Bros., she served as casting coordinator on the 2008 Emmy-nominated television show, "JUSTICE LEAGUE: THE NEW FRONTIER," an experience that she finds particularly gratifying.

Throughout her career, Ms. Smith has developed expertise in post-production sound, studio operations, project management, event coordination, marketing, writing, process design, and collaboration with database programmers, and she has shared her knowledge as a public speaker in a variety of venues. She has also published articles online, in trade magazines and in newspapers.

Certified as a digital filmmaker by Travel Channel associates, Ms. Smith received a Bachelor of Arts in Communications from Morehead State University. Furthermore, she holds a postgraduate certification in Management and Marketing from Indiana University and a postgraduate certificate in Human Resources and Labor Relations from Cornell University. With strong interests in script doctoring, reading, and film and television editing, she maintains memberships in the Academy of Television Arts and Sciences, Alliance of Women in Media, Women in Film, the American Film Institute, NAMIC, and the Society of Motion Picture and Television Engineers.
